Output d90c875eabbb20ca976b8cb58b1d2c285d3ccf9400855c0548f98836c370e0be:57

value
295321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68132ecbed5b5ae3a9dff6b26011ba81a963a8ef OP_EQUAL
address
3BBKBLaXtMgqx7W2Byadu7WebqhByj2aX1
transaction
d90c875eabbb20ca976b8cb58b1d2c285d3ccf9400855c0548f98836c370e0be
spent
true